Staff Presentation
~
Ch ri s Neubecker, Senior Pl a nn er, was sworn in. Mr. N e ub ecke r outlined the changes that
are proposed to the c urre nt code. The propo sed c han ges to the code are :
1) Removing the 30 day deadlin e for staff to provide a written report of the
ne ig hborhood m eeti ng .
2) Delete referenc es to the Deve lopm e nt Revi ew Team decisions.
3) Change pro ced ures for nei g hborhood me etin gs . A separate docume nt outlining the
department's policy and procedures regarding neighborhood m eetings was
supp li ed to the Commissioners.
4) Req uire the public hea rin g for PUD s to be he ld within 180 days of the
ne ig hborhood m ee tin g.
5) The rezon in g process and req uirem e nts are a ll conta in ed with in section 16-2-8
rather than in multipl e sections. Refe re n ces to PUD s in sect io n 16-2-7 have been
deleted.
Commissioner's Comments
~
Mr. Knoth asked about the timeline for the wr itte n com m e nts on the neighborhood
meeting a nd w h at th e co ns eq ue nces of not co mpletin g the comme nts wou ld be.
~
Mr. Neubecker respo nd ed that Staff is acco untab le to the Planning and Zoning
Commissio n and that Staff ge nerally has the c omm e nts prepared wel l in adva nce of the
Public H ea ring for a case . In most cases, the written co mments are prepared within a few
days of the neighborhood meeting.
~
Ms. Reid added that the 30 day time limit on preparing the neighborhood meeting notes is
a policy and not a stat ute . Th e proposed meet in g procedu res in clude verbiage out linin g
the timeline for staff to complete th e notes .
~
Mr. Roth as ked if neighborhood me etin gs are posted for the pub li c. Mr. Neubecker
responded that there are require ments for m a ilin gs of noti ce to property owne rs and
occ upants within 1000 feet of the subject prop e rty and a noti ce is posted o n t he property.
The requirements for the posting are outlined in the nei g hborhoo d meeting procedures
and in th e code.

VI. STAFF'S CHOICE
~
Director White reviewed the case for Signature Senior Living Cas e #USE2014-00 3 . The
applicant requested a letter to assist with financing stating that th ey are permitted to build
134 units. An Administrative Decision to allow the applicant to have 134 units was m ad e
after review of the parking plan and other revisions to the site plan. The d ecision c an be
appealed , in writing, within 30 days from the date of this meetin g . The project was
approved as a Conditional Use that must be reviewed annually. The applicant is op e n to
pursuing other options with regards to parking should it become an issue in th e future.
Mr. Bleile stated that he agreed with Director White's decision , Mr. King concurred.
